    Decoding the City Fitness Westgate Busy Hours: A Detailed Breakdown

    Alright, let's get down to the nitty-gritty and analyze the City Fitness Westgate busy hours. Generally speaking, the peak times tend to coincide with before and after work hours, and during lunch breaks. Think early mornings (5:00 AM - 8:00 AM), evenings (4:00 PM - 8:00 PM), and the midday rush (11:00 AM - 1:00 PM). These times usually see the highest foot traffic, meaning more people, less available equipment, and potentially longer waits. However, the exact dynamics can fluctuate depending on the day of the week, holidays, and even the weather.

    • Early Mornings (5:00 AM - 8:00 AM): These hours are popular with the early birds looking to kickstart their day with a workout before heading to work or school. You'll find a mix of people, from seasoned athletes to those just trying to squeeze in some exercise before their schedules get hectic. The atmosphere is generally energetic, with everyone focused on their individual routines. Cardio equipment and free weights are usually in high demand, so arrive early if these are your go-to choices.
    • Lunch Breaks (11:00 AM - 1:00 PM): This midday slot is a favorite for those wanting a quick workout during their lunch break. Expect a somewhat crowded environment, especially in areas with cardio machines and weight machines. Circuit training and quick workouts are popular during this time. Parking might be a bit challenging, and you may encounter a short wait to use the most popular equipment.
    • Evenings (4:00 PM - 8:00 PM): The evening rush is usually the busiest time at City Fitness Westgate. This is when people finish work and head to the gym. The crowd includes a diverse group of people, from students to professionals, all winding down their day. Be prepared for longer waits for equipment, particularly during the peak of this period (6:00 PM - 7:00 PM). Group fitness classes are in full swing, adding to the buzz.

    Weekends can have a different rhythm. While mornings (9:00 AM - 12:00 PM) tend to be busier, the flow is usually more spread out compared to weekdays. The atmosphere is often more relaxed, and it can be a great time to focus on your workout without feeling as rushed.

    Pro Tips for Navigating the City Fitness Westgate Crowds

    Okay, so you've got the lowdown on the City Fitness Westgate busy hours, now let's equip you with some pro tips to make your gym visits smoother, even during peak times. Here’s how you can outsmart the crowds and maximize your workout potential:

    • Timing is Everything: Aim to go outside of peak hours. Early mornings (before 7:00 AM) or late evenings (after 7:00 PM) can often be less crowded. During the midday lull (1:00 PM - 4:00 PM), you might find more space. Experiment with different times to discover your sweet spot.
    • Plan Your Workout: Have a workout plan ready before you go. This helps you stay focused and reduces the time you spend wandering around trying to decide what to do. Know which machines or areas you need and prioritize your routine accordingly.
    • Embrace Circuit Training: Circuit training is your friend during crowded times. It keeps you moving and allows you to utilize various equipment stations in a short amount of time, reducing your reliance on any single machine. This is a game-changer.
    • Utilize Free Weight Areas: Free weight areas often have more space, especially when compared to the highly coveted machines. If you're comfortable with free weights, this can be a great way to avoid long waits.
    • Be Flexible: Have alternative exercises in mind. If your preferred machine is occupied, be ready to switch to something else, or try an alternative exercise that works the same muscle groups. Flexibility is key.
    • Communicate and Share: Don't be shy about asking how long someone will be on a machine. Most people are courteous and willing to share equipment, especially if you’re friendly. Taking turns and sharing equipment will help make the workout go faster and keep the peace.
    • Consider Group Classes: If you enjoy group classes, they can be a great way to structure your workout and avoid the need to compete for equipment. Plus, they offer a social and motivating environment.
    • Parking Strategy: Arrive early or be prepared to park a bit further away. Knowing the parking situation can also save you time and frustration.
    • Stay Hydrated and Bring a Towel: Always bring a water bottle to stay hydrated, and a towel to wipe down equipment after use. This shows respect for the gym and other users.
    • Check the App or Website: Many gyms have apps or websites where you can view class schedules, check equipment availability, and sometimes even see a live view of how busy the gym is. Take advantage of these features.

    Alternative Workout Strategies for Busy Times

    Sometimes, even with the best planning, you might find yourself at City Fitness Westgate during the City Fitness Westgate busy hours. Don't fret! Here are some alternative workout strategies to ensure you still get an effective workout, even when the gym is packed:

    • Bodyweight Exercises: Embrace the power of bodyweight exercises! These require no equipment and can be done anywhere in the gym. Think push-ups, squats, lunges, planks, and various core exercises. You can create a full-body workout using just your own body weight.
    • Focus on Cardio Alternatives: If treadmills and ellipticals are packed, switch to other cardio options like the stair climber, rowing machine, or even the stationary bike. These might be less crowded and offer a great workout.
    • Utilize the Functional Training Area: City Fitness Westgate likely has a functional training area with equipment like kettlebells, medicine balls, and resistance bands. These are great for versatile workouts and can often be less crowded than the main machine areas.
    • Prioritize Compound Exercises with Free Weights: Compound exercises, such as squats, deadlifts, bench presses, and overhead presses, work multiple muscle groups simultaneously, making them highly efficient. Use free weights for these, as they may have more space than machines.
    • Tabata or HIIT Workouts: High-Intensity Interval Training (HIIT) or Tabata workouts are designed to be short and incredibly effective. These can be easily adapted to a variety of exercises and done in a small space, making them perfect for crowded gyms.
    • Explore Stretching and Mobility: Use the time to focus on stretching and improving your mobility. This can be done in a quiet corner of the gym, and it's a great way to improve your flexibility and prevent injuries. Think of it as active recovery.
    • Go Outdoors (If Possible): On nice days, consider an outdoor workout. This could involve running, cycling, bodyweight exercises at a park, or even a hike. Taking your workout outside can be a refreshing change of pace.
